WebMolded Case Circuit Breakers. Molded case circuit breakers provide branch or feeder circuit protection against overload or short-circuits, using thermal-magnetic or electronic trip units. UL489 rated MCCBs are available in various frame sizes for 3-pole configurations up to 1200A. WebUL 218 Fire pump controllers requires both and isolating switch and circuit breaker. Edit: Its more likey that its an automatic switch and MCP then both MCPs. Fire Pumps are required to run indefinitely at 300% FLA and have a trip curve up to 1400% so all the times over current protection is built into the controller.
